Securityenhanced linux red hat enterprise linux 6 red. Permanent changes in selinux states and modes red hat. When using rhel, it is assumed that you have registered your system using red hat subscription management and that you have the rhel 7serverrpms repository enabled by default. These sample files should work fine for getting started with nagios. When selinux is disabled, selinux policy is not loaded at all. On rpmbased distributions, such as red hat enterprise linux rhel, centos, fedora or scientific linux, you can install jenkins through yum. Open the etc selinux config file in some systems, the etcsysconfig selinux file. Feb 24, 2019 this guide will help you to setup phppgadmin 5. Jul 25, 2019 disable selinux in centos, rhel and fedora for starters, selinux is described as a mandatory access control mac security structure executed in the kernel. Set selinux permissive on android using the selinux switch.
Get docker engine enterprise for red hat enterprise. Mar 07, 2012 this is the 1st video in series of videos on rhel it covers the small topic of firewall and selinux. Download container selinux packages for centos, fedora. Think about this carefully, and if your system is on the internet and accessed by the public, then think about it some more. The other available mode for running selinux in enabled state is permissive. I need to make sure i do a complete inventory on the filespolicy changes for now on. This is the second article in the introduction to selinux series. Some agent and proxy packages are available for rhel 6 and rhel 5 as well. Verify container selinux version in your server with below command. Oct 08, 2017 now that the app is installed on your android, you can easily use it to enable selinux permissive mode. This tools is a free and open source package designed for system administrators to manage the functionality of apache web server from a browser, such as edit configuration and web document files directly from browser, download, search or visualize apache logs in real time, install, edit or remove apache. Installing the selinux from the centos repository worked for me.
When selinux is running in enforcing mode, it enforces the selinux policy and denies access based on selinux policy rules. The configuration file for selinux is located in etc selinux config path. It is enabled by default on most of the linux distribution that we use for servers like centos. In red hat enterprise linux, enforcing mode is enabled by default when the system was initially installed with selinux. To disable selinux, without having to reboot, you can use the. Use the getenforce or sestatus commands to check the status of selinux. To download the source package containing the currently used kernel. After the frontend and selinux configuration is done, restart the apache web server. There are some tasks you can do to prevent from unwanted results. In this tutorial, we will show you how to disable selinux on centos 7 systems. Later, in centos 5 this number had risen to over 200 targets. That meant by the post installation step, selinux is already active. Yes, you have to have an active rhel subscription to download packages from rhel s repositories. Here is the small guide for disabling selinux on centos 76 rhel 76.
Before disabling selinux, check first its mode of operation. So, go to the app drawer and launch the selinux switch app. In centos5, we only need download selinux policy source and have a little update then recompile. Installing jenkins on red hat distributions jenkins. Securityenhanced linux selinux adds mandatory access control mac to the linux kernel, and is enabled by default in red hat enterprise linux. Oct 21, 2019 the configuration file for selinux is located in etc selinux config path. Disabling selinux red hat enterprise linux 6 red hat. It gives the systems administrator a finer grain of control than what the kernel typically provides. These enhancements mean that content varies as to how to approach selinux over time to solve problems. Selinux stands for securityenhanced linux and it is developed by the nsa national security agency.
Working with selinux red hat enterprise linux 6 red. Disable selinux centos 6 you need to be aware that by disabling selinux you will be removing a security mechanism on your centos system. Here is the small guide for disabling selinux on centos 7 6 rhel 7 6. As you download and use centos linux, the centos project invites you to be a part of the community as a contributor. Here is the small guide for disabling selinux on centos 7 6 rhel 7 6 switch to the root user. Download selinuxpolicytargeted packages for alt linux, centos, fedora, mageia. Selinux was first introduced in centos 4 and significantly enhanced in later centos releases. Get docker engine enterprise for red hat enterprise linux. Red hat enterprise linux 8 essentials print and ebook epubpdfkindle editions contain 31 chapters and over 250 pages. If not, take a look at how to install postgresql 11 10 on centos 7 rhel 7. Red hat global support services recommends disabling selinux permanently only if you are certain you will never want to run selinux in the future. Selinux users and administrators guide red hat enterprise. If these packages are not installed, as the linux root user, install them via the yum install packagename command. Once thats saved, you can ensure it has proper ownership and selinux context.
See instructions for installing zabbix frontend on red hat enterprise linuxcentos 7. How do i turn selinux off in red hat enterprise linux. I am trying to install docker ce on rhel using this link. If you use rhel 6 please read the section about using zabbix frontend on rhel 6 on how to configure the frontend. Use the usrsbingetenforce or usrsbinsestatus commands to check the status of selinux.
Red hat enterprise linux 6 securityenhanced linux user guide mirek jahoda. Edit the etc selinux config file and set the selinux to disabled. Jan 04, 2020 disables selinux from the system but is only read at boot time. This article provides updated and generalized information. Securityenhanced linux selinux is a linux feature that provides security mechanism for supporting access control security policies implemented in the kernel. Centos appstream aarch64 official container selinux 2. Its the foundation from which you can scale existing appsand roll out emerging technologiesacross baremetal, virtual, container, and all types of cloud environments. How to install docker on redhat linux rhel and centos.
Download selinuxpolicybase packages for alt linux, centos, fedora, mageia. In this article, we are going to demonstrate the docker community edition deployment on rhel centos. Thank you for the update, i did not know the 6 to 6. In redhat enterprise linux 6 rhel 6 minimal server installation, selinux is set to enable. A general purpose mac architecture needs the ability to enforce an administrativelyset security policy over all processes and files in the system, basing decisions on labels containing a variety of. Rhel 6 78 semanage selinux command not found last updated december 30, 2019 in categories centos, linux, redhat and friends i m trying to use semanage command to configure certain elements of selinux policy without requiring modification to or recompilation from policy sources under rhel 6 server. If your machine has never been subscribed, or the subscription is expired, you will not be able to use any of the repositories provided by rhel. In this article we shall walk through steps you can follow to check the status of selinux and also disable it in centos 6. To disabled the selinux, please change selinux enforcing to selinux disabled.
Rhel 678 semanage selinux command not found nixcraft. Register if you are a new customer, register now for access to product evaluations and purchasing capabilities. Virtual ip on a virtual nic for production the virtual ip will be a public ip here the virtual ip is. In this section, you will install various selinux packages that will help you when creating. How to enable or disable selinux and check status on centos. Sample configuration files have now been installed in the usrlocalnagiosetc directory. It gives you fine control over all programs and daemons on their activities like communicating with out side programs continue reading how to enable or disable. Mongodb atlas is a hosted mongodb service in the cloud that can have you up and running in minutes. How to setup the docker environment to start the first container to start exploring the container world.
To disable selinux, open the configuration file and set the selinux parameter to disabled. Before starting with the tutorial, make sure you are logged in as a user with sudo privileges. These iso images can be found in either a 32 bit or 64 bit option. Installing owncloud 9 on centos rhel is quite simple. Upgrading centos 6 to centos 7 november 15th, 2018 whplus. How to install owncloud 9 server on centosrhel 7 and 6. Installing sphinxsearch redhatcentos helpspot support. First method to check the selinux status is using sestatus command. To install docker on rhel 7 6 you need container selinux version minimum 2. Verify it by running the sestatus and getenforce again. Well cover how to install sphinxsearch on redhat and centos servers.
Add the jenkins repository to the yum repos, and install jenkins from here. If you are a new customer, register now for access to product evaluations and purchasing capabilities. Selinux offers a means of enforcing some security policies which would otherwise not be effectively implemented by a system administrator. Get started for free with the atlas free tier and scale up ondemand. Learning the basics but importance of selinux in rhel centos. Red hat enterprise linux 8 essentials book now available. Also, by default, selinux targeted policy is used, and selinux runs in enforcing mode. The default policy in centos is the targeted policy which targets and confines selected system processes. Selinux is a linux feature that provides a mechanism for supporting access control security policies in the linux kernel. In red hat enterprise linux, the selinux packages are installed by default, in a full. Originally, this bug was filed because the openstack selinux package directly conflicted with the rhel 6.
For more information on registering the system, see the red hat enterprise linux 7 system administrators guide. In this post, i will share on how to check securityenhanced linux selinux status on red hat enterprise linux 6 rhel 6. Modifying selinux settings for full nginx and nginx plus. Ok, so the synopsis changed and i forgot to update the bugzilla. The selinux stands for securityenhanced linux where it is a linux kernel security module. Access the full set of supported packages included with the subscription at install time. Before we dive into setting the selinux modes, let us see what are the different selinux modes of operation and how do they work. Disable selinux in centos, rhel and fedora for starters, selinux is described as a mandatory access control mac security structure executed in the kernel. Selinux gives that extra layer of security to the resources in the system. Dec 30, 2019 rhel 678 semanage selinux command not found last updated december 30, 2019 in categories centos, linux, redhat and friends i m trying to use semanage command to configure certain elements of selinux policy without requiring modification to or recompilation from policy sources under rhel 6 server. How to check selinux status on rhel 6 web hosting geeks.
Your red hat account gives you access to your profile, preferences, and services, depending on your status. Assuming that you already have installed postgresql on your system. In addition to rhel 7serverrpms, you also need to have the rhel 7serveroptionalrpms, rhel 7server. As soon as the interface initiates, you shall see a prompt for root permissions. Entering a red hat enterprise linux 5 subscription number lets the installer. Disable selinux on centos 7 rhel 7 fedora linux nixcraft.
If you have trouble with selinux using the packages under the 7 directory, try choosing the versionspecific directory instead, such as 7. Apr 17, 2018 selinux is a set of extra security restrictions on top of the normal linux security tools. Centos stream is a midstream distribution that provides a clearedpath for participation in creating the next version of rhel. Automatically register the system to all red hat network rhn channels included with the subscription at install time. Todays legacy hadoop migrationblock access to businesscritical applications, deliver inconsistent data, and risk data loss. Stop the selinux, and update the date time on the server. Selinux policy generation tool beginners guide to selinux how to disable or set selinux to permissive mode how to check whether selinux is enabled or disabled filed under. The getenforce command returns enforcing, permissive, or disabled. The centos 6 installer loads the policies in permissive mode by default which i confirmed by running dmesg during the installation. Download selinux policydevel packages for alt linux, centos, fedora, mageia. How to enable or disable selinux in centosrhel 7 posted by jarrod on september 21, 2016 leave a comment 4 go to comments security enhanced linux selinux is enabled and running in enforcing mode by default in centos rhel based linux operating systems, and with good reason as it increases overall system security.
The selinux is the additional security module referred to the enterprise linux. Selinux is a set of extra security restrictions on top of the normal linux security tools. Download selinux policy packages for alt linux, centos, fedora, mageia, ubuntu. This article focuses on selinux types and domains, which relate to file and process contexts. The former describes the basics and principles upon which selinux functions, the latter is more focused on practical tasks to set up and configure various services. Oct 17, 2011 disable selinux centos 6 you need to be aware that by disabling selinux you will be removing a security mechanism on your centos system. Centos 6 kickstart ignoring selinux disabled server fault.
It is recommended to keep selinux in enforcing mode, but in some cases, you may need to set it to a permissive mode or disable it completely. After changing the selinux status we need to reboot the server. Files created with selinux disabled will not have the information necessary to function when selinux is enabled. By design, selinux allows different policies to be written that are interchangeable. Use permissive mode if you just need to debug your system. Jenkins requires java in order to run, yet certain distros dont include this.
If your company has an existing red hat account, your organization administrator can grant you access. The default settings for securityenhanced linux selinux on modern red hat enterprise linux rhel and related distros can be very strict, erring on the side of. See installation instructions per platform in the download page for. It provides the mac mandatory access control as contrary to the dac discretionary access control. Let us see all commands, examples and usage in details. Dec 28, 2016 owncloud is a dropboxlike solution for selfhosted file sharing and syncing. Securityenhanced linux selinux is a mandatory access control mac security mechanism implemented in the kernel. Selinux policy must be enabled to centos rhel to enable security policies belongs to linux. Explains how to install semanage selinux command under centos rhel fedora scientific linux when you get error bash. In centos 4 only 15 defined targets existed including d, named, dhcpd, mysqld. Selinux checking for allowed operations after standard linux discretionary access controls are checked.
The software provided by this project complements the selinux features integrated into the linux kernel and is used by linux distributions. Choose your red hat enterprise linux version, architecture, and docker version. Install mongodb community edition on red hat or centos. Changing selinux states and modes fedora docs site. Selinux policybase download for linux rpm download selinux policybase linux packages for alt linux, centos, fedora, mageia. The following is a brief description of the selinux packages that are installed on your system by default. Securityenhanced linux red hat enterprise linux 6 red hat. In this tutorial we will configure selinux modes on centos 8 rhel 8. Dec 03, 2012 centos rhel and linux kernel with selinux licensed under gpl v. In this mode, selinux policy is enforced and it denies access based on selinux policy rules. Red hat enterprise linux is the worlds leading enterprise linux platform. How to enabledisable selinux modes in rhelcentos the geek. We will also launch the docker containers to test the deployment.